Why do aluminum coils have rolling problems after high temperature refrigeration?

发布时间:2020-8-29 15:04:46      点击次数:872

In the whole process of aluminum coil making, in order to help change its appearance, the aluminum coil manufacturer must carry out high temperature heating to solve it. In the case of high temperature, it will be softer and its appearance is also very easy to produce After some changes, after the appearance is adjusted, its temperature can be reduced to maintain a certain strength. However, in some cases, after the high temperature refrigeration is carried out, the aluminum coil will have some rolling problems. What is going on What?

The bending condition occurs during cooling. The reason is: under the general air-cooled standard, the heat transfer index of each part of the aluminum coil is similar to that of the gas, but due to the difference in thickness or appearance, the heat dissipation rate of the heat pipe of each part is not the same. In balance, the aluminum coil manufacturer causes the heat pipe heat dissipation rate of the thin-walled part or the hollow tube to be slower than the thick-walled part, causing it to be bumpy to the hollow part or the part with thicker wall during cooling.

The reason for bending and the whole process are as follows:

1. The temperature of the thick-walled part decreases quickly, causing the shrinkage first, and the temperature of the thin-walled part or the hollow tube decreases slowly, and there is basically no shrinkage;

2. Part of the thick wall has a small cross-section, resulting in small contraction force, or it is removed by the driving force of the optical cable tractor;

3. When leaving the optical cable tractor, the temperature drops again;

4. Part of the thin-walled part or part of the hollow tube has a large cross-section. As the temperature decreases, it slowly causes a large shrinkage force. The temperature of the thick-walled part has been greatly reduced, and no shrinkage force or small shrinkage force is caused;

5. The shrinkage force on the cross section of the aluminum coil is uneven, and the thin wall part or the hollow tube part is bent along the extrusion molding direction.
